Abstract
According to certain aspects, a memory subsystem is coupled to a memory controller of a host computer system via an interface. The memory subsystem comprises dynamic random access memory elements and a memory subsystem controller. During a normal memory read or write operation, the memory subsystem controller is configured to receive address and command signals associated with the memory read or write operations and to control the dynamic random access memory elements in accordance with the address and command signals. The memory subsystem controller is further configured to output via the open drain output a parity error signal in response to a parity error having occurred during the memory read or write operation. During an initialization operation, the memory subsystem controller is configured to output via the open train output a signal related to one or more parts of initialization operation sequences.
